The Science of NAD+

NAD+ (n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ide) is a vital coenzyme found in all living cells. You can think of it as the body’s little helper, essential for energy production, cellular well-being, and maintaining healthy brain function.

NAD+ The biological powerhouse

Although NAD+ isn’t a cure-all, it is celebrated for its possible advantages in promoting overall wellness.

Here are some important areas where NAD+ supplementation may excel:

NAD+ is a big factor in the brain’s ability to repair DNA, regulate neuroplasticity, and fight oxidative stress. These functions are crucial for memory, focus, and overall cognitive health. Increasing NAD+ levels may offer advantages for those with a history of neurodegenerative diseases or cognitive decline.

Mitochondria, known as the cell’s powerhouses, depend on NAD+ for optimal energy production. With NAD+, mitochondrial performance is enhanced, leading to better ATP production. This results in higher energy levels and less fatigue.

Healthy mitochondria are essential not just for energy production but also for managing cellular metabolism and signalling. NAD+  may support the repair and rejuvenation of mitochondria. It’s particularly advantageous for individuals facing metabolic slowdowns due to aging or dealing with chronic fatigue.

NAD+ plays a vital role in important biological functions such as DNA repair, managing inflammation, and regulating gene expression. These processes are crucial for preserving cellular health and lowering the chances of developing age-related illnesses.

NAD+ plays a crucial role in repairing cellular damage that can result from toxins, stress, or illness. People who have a background of chronic stress, substance use, or long-term health issues frequently notice quicker recovery and a general feeling of revitalization after undergoing therapy.

How your NAD+ infusion will work

Consultation & assessment

Before starting NAD+ IV therapy, one of our professional nurses evaluates your health history, lifestyle, and wellness goals. This step ensures that the therapy is customised to fit your individual needs and is conducted safely.

Preparation of the infusion

A sterile solution containing NAD+ is created. This coenzyme has been linked to cellular function, energy management and minimising oxidative stress, leading to enhanced vitality.

IV placement

Our skilled nurses will insert a small needle into a vein in your arm. This method allows the NAD+ solution to flow directly into your bloodstream, ensuring increased absorption by bypassing the digestive system.

The infusion process

The NAD+ solution is administered slowly over a period of 1 to 4 hours, depending on the prescribed dose. During this time, patients can relax in a comfortable setting. 

Post treatment recovery

After your NAD+ IV infusion you may feel mild fatigue. We suggest avoiding strenuous activity for a few hours after your treatment to give your body time to rest and process.

Patients often report host of wellness benefits after treatment – including elevated mood and energy levels.

However, these effects may be subtle until the next day or multiple days after a treatment. Often patients require several IV treatments to experience significant benefits.

While most people tolerate NAD IV therapy well, some may experience mild side effects like:

Temporary flushing or warmth during the infusion.
Nausea (usually resolved by adjusting the drip rate).
Fatigue or a mild headache after the session.

During your initial consultation, you’ll discuss these side effects with our registered nurses before starting treatment.

NAD IV therapy isn’t suitable for:

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als. Those with certain medical conditions or on specific medications. Anyone advised against it by their healthcare provider.
